How to configure shipping methods

Learn how to set up available shipping methods in your store, including InPost, digital delivery, and custom shipping options.

Updated this week

Shipping methods allow your customers to choose their preferred delivery method when completing their order. In Shopable, you can configure several types of shipping: InPost parcel lockers, digital delivery, and custom shipping methods such as DPD courier or in-person pickup.

Once you've configured your shipping methods, they will be displayed in the checkout form. Keep in mind that after an order is placed, you need to manually ship the package with your chosen carrier โ€“ Shopable does not handle automatic integration with courier companies.

Accessing shipping method settings

Go to the Settings section in the side menu, then select the Shipping methods tab. You'll see a list of available delivery options and the ability to add your own methods.

Configuring InPost parcel lockers

InPost is one of the predefined shipping methods in Shopable. To activate it:

  1. In the Configured delivery methods section, find the InPost entry with the "Inactive" label.

  2. Click the Configure button next to this method.

  3. Enable the Activate InPost shipping method toggle at the top of the form.

  4. In the Shipping method name field, you can keep the default name or enter your own, e.g., "InPost Parcel Lockers".

  5. Set the Delivery price โ€“ enter the cost you want to charge customers for this method.

  6. If you want shipping to be free for purchases above a certain amount, enable the Free delivery from amount option and enter the threshold amount.

  7. In the Expected delivery time field, specify the time in days, e.g., "2".

  8. Click Save changes.

Remember: After enabling this method, customers will be able to select an InPost pickup point in the checkout form. However, after an order is placed, you need to manually ship the package to the parcel locker according to the pickup point chosen by the customer.

After saving, the InPost method will change its status to "Active" and will be visible in your store's checkout.

Configuring digital delivery

Digital delivery is intended for products you deliver electronically (e.g., e-books, online courses, downloadable files). To configure it:

  1. Find the Digital Delivery entry with the "Active" label in the delivery methods section.

  2. Click Configure.

  3. Make sure the Activate digital shipping method toggle is enabled.

  4. In the Shipping method name field, enter the name that will be displayed to customers, e.g., "Digital delivery".

  5. Click Save changes.

Note: Activating this method makes it appear in the cart during checkout. By default, the shipping cost is 0.00 PLN. After an order is placed, you need to manually send the digital material to the customer (e.g., via the email address provided in the order).

Adding custom shipping methods

If you want to offer other forms of delivery, such as DPD courier, in-person pickup, or courier shipment, you can create your own shipping method.

  1. In the Custom shipping methods section, click the Create custom shipping method button.

  2. In the Shipping method name field, enter the name that will be displayed to customers, e.g., "Courier".

  3. Set the Delivery price โ€“ if you enter "0", the method will be displayed as free.

  4. You can enable the Free delivery from amount option to offer free shipping on higher-value orders.

  5. In the Expected delivery time field, specify the time in days.

  6. Click Save changes.

Information: This shipping method does not support parcel locker deliveries or automatic integration with carriers. After receiving an order, manually ship the package with your chosen carrier.

The created method will appear in the Custom shipping methods table and will be available to customers at checkout.

Managing shipping methods

You can edit or delete created methods at any time. To do this:

  • Click the ... icon (three dots) next to the selected method in the table.

  • Choose the edit option to change parameters, or delete the method if it's no longer needed.

Once you've configured your shipping methods, customers will be able to select their preferred delivery option when placing an order. This allows you to tailor your offering to different preferences and provide a better shopping experience.
